Hey DLK, two of my sons are teaching themselves how to play guitar. One plays trumpet already and has made first chair in the Regional UIL Band 2 years in a row and made second chair the year before that. The other plays the Euphonium and the Tuba. He made third chair in UIL this year.
Do you have any suggestions for instruction books that I can get them?
I forget the name of the books that I started with, but the author was Chet Atkins. There's also a series of books by Tommy Todesco that are very good. Important to note though is both of these recommendations use notation, not tablature.
One bit of advice that I would absolutely give is that since they already read music, make sure that whichever course or books you get emphasize reading music. I also personally recommend having material around for sight-reading (not just for the guitar, btw, but for their horns as well). I personally use the "MicroKosmos" by Bela Bartok for that.
